A Magic Night

More than 500 people turned out for the Children’s Theatre Company’s eighteenth annual “Magic” Curtain Call Ball, raising $475,000 for CTC’s programs. Guests were treated to dinner, dancing, and live jazz music, and participated in live and silent auctions where they had the chance to bid on such items as a walk-on role in CTC’s spring play The Magic Mrs. Piggle-Wiggle.
